Ontario Human Rights Code. In Ontario, the Human Rights Code applies to both tenants and landlords. As per the Code, both parties have the right to equal treatment in housing, without any harassment or discrimination. Most rented homes in Ontario are covered by 3 rules about rent increases: The landlord must wait at least one year between increases.
